Position Overview

We are seeking a Senior AI Architect to join our growing AI & Advisory practice and serve as a senior architecture leader for Atlas Technica’s Ukraine-based AI capability. This is a highly technical, hands-on, and client-facing role focused on designing secure AI solutions, leading complex client engagements, and guiding AI Engineers as solutions move from initial concept through validation and production readiness.

The Senior AI Architect will work closely with the Principal AI Architect and Global Head of AI & Advisory to translate business and technical requirements into practical AI architectures, establish reusable delivery standards, and help develop Atlas Technica’s offshore AI Center of Excellence. This role will also contribute to the design and use of Atlas’s AI lab and validation environments to determine when emerging technologies, patterns, and solutions are ready for client use.

The successful candidate will combine deep technical and architecture expertise with strong client communication, leadership, sound judgment, and a hands-on approach. This is not a purely conceptual architecture role; the Senior AI Architect must be comfortable reviewing code, testing assumptions, troubleshooting integrations, and stepping into implementation when needed.

Position Responsibilities

Serve as a senior technical and architecture advisor for selected financial services clients, leading technical discovery, architecture workshops, design reviews, and ongoing working sessions

Translate client business priorities into practical AI roadmaps, architecture decisions, implementation approaches, and clearly defined technical requirements

Architect secure AI applications and agentic workflows across Microsoft Azure, Microsoft 365, SharePoint, Microsoft Entra ID, Azure AI Foundry, enterprise data platforms, APIs, and approved AI models

Define appropriate identity, permissions, data access, networking, secrets management, logging, auditing, human-review, and least-privilege controls for AI solutions

Evaluate architecture decisions and technical risks across model selection, retrieval, memory, integrations, deployment, security, cost, resilience, maintainability, and production supportability

Convert validated prototypes and proofs of concept into implementation-ready architecture, scope, assumptions, technical standards, and acceptance criteria

Provide architecture leadership to AI Engineers by reviewing code, implementation evidence, testing results, deployment plans, and technical documentation while maintaining accountability for overall architecture quality

Identify and communicate architecture, delivery, security, capacity, vendor, and client-dependency risks early and clearly

Help establish Atlas Technica’s Ukraine-based AI Center of Excellence, including reference architectures, engineering standards, technical review practices, reusable patterns, documentation expectations, and mentoring approaches

Mentor AI Engineers and developing architects while helping create a scalable architecture-and-engineering delivery model across multiple client engagements

Partner with AI leadership to design and utilize Atlas’s AI lab and validation environments, including test scenarios, evaluation criteria, evidence requirements, and production-readiness gates

Research, test, and validate new AI platforms, agents, connectors, security controls, and architecture patterns before recommending broader client adoption

Requirements

10+ years of experience across software, cloud, data, security, solution architecture, or related technical disciplines, including significant experience leading complex architecture decisions

Hands-on experience designing and delivering production AI, machine learning, data, or agentic systems

Strong Microsoft Azure architecture experience across application hosting, identity, networking, storage, databases, logging, security, and deployment patterns

Practical experience with Azure AI Foundry, Azure OpenAI or comparable AI platforms, retrieval-augmented generation (RAG), embeddings, vector or hybrid search, and agent orchestration

Experience designing APIs, data integrations, secure connectors, and MCP or comparable tool-integration patterns

Strong knowledge of Microsoft 365, SharePoint, Microsoft Entra ID, role-based access control, Microsoft Graph, and least-privilege access design

Working proficiency in Python with the ability to review implementation code, scripts, infrastructure definitions, technical logs, and other engineering outputs

Strong experience designing secure systems with appropriate environment separation, identity and access controls, secrets management, audit logging, observability, and human-review safeguards

Demonstrated ability to evaluate technical risk, distinguish prototypes from production-ready solutions, and make sound architecture decisions based on evidence

Strong written and spoken English with the ability to lead technical conversations with senior client executives, portfolio managers, quantitative teams, developers, security leaders, and other technical and non-technical stakeholders

Experience mentoring engineers, providing technical direction, and delegating implementation work while maintaining architecture quality and delivery accountability

Strong client-facing, communication, documentation, problem-solving, and decision-making skills

Desirable Qualities

Experience supporting hedge funds, private equity firms, asset managers, banks, or other regulated financial institutions

Experience with Microsoft Purview, Defender for Cloud Apps, Microsoft Intune, data-loss prevention, sensitivity labels, and compliance-focused logging

Familiarity with Azure Functions, Azure Container Apps, Azure SQL, PostgreSQL, Cosmos DB, Snowflake, Docker, CI/CD, GitHub Actions, and Infrastructure as Code

Experience evaluating third-party or internally developed AI applications for security, architecture quality, and production readiness

Experience establishing an architecture practice, technical review board, Center of Excellence, offshore engineering capability, or similar technical governance structure

Relevant Microsoft, Azure, cloud architecture, AI, security, or related professional certifications

Ability to communicate complex technical decisions clearly, challenge assumptions constructively, and recommend practical alternatives when proposed approaches introduce unnecessary risk

Demonstrated commitment to strong documentation, explicit ownership, reliable follow-through, and evidence-based technical decision-making
